Q: Is 43,521,326 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 43,521,326 is not a prime number.

Why is 43,521,326 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 43521326 can be evenly divided by 1 2 17 34 163 326 2,771 5,542 7,853 15,706 133,501 267,002 1,280,039 2,560,078 21,760,663 and 43,521,326, with no remainder.

Since 43,521,326 cannot be divided by just 1 and 43,521,326, it is not a prime number.
